Almandine Garnet – Meaning
As a protective stone, garnet is said to strengthen vitality and our basic survival instincts. It’s also said to support fertility and libido. In the Middle Ages, garnet was worn as a protective talisman against ill will and misfortune. On a mental level, almandine is said to clear away negativity and ease melancholy and depression, while also bringing courage and hope in critical moments.
To protect themselves and strengthen their courage, medieval crusaders wore garnet on their journeys to the Holy Land — and today, business people wear it for similar reasons during important negotiations. Interestingly, some Asian and Indian tribes once used garnet as arrowheads: its dark red colour made shattered fragments harder to find and remove from the body. In ancient Egypt, garnet was associated with the goddess of war, Sekhmet, often depicted with a lion’s head and a woman’s body.
As a stone of physical love, garnet is said to help partners understand each other’s needs and desires. It’s also believed to create a rare connection between the Root and Crown chakras, helping bring mental energy into the physical body.
